Hey, so I'm going to attempt to do my own transmission service tomorrow and was wondering what exactly do I need to do this? Looking to do a standard transmission fluid change and replace the filter. How much fluid, what tools, parts, and do I have to have one of those adapters or can I just shove the hose inside the pan? Probably will go ahead and do the transfer case as well if y'all recommend it.
Thank you.

About six quarts of MercV for the transmission. Get one of the pumps that screw onto the bottle, looks like a soap dispenser. Yes do the transfer case too but I'm not going to mention the fluid type.
 






Drained the pan and replaced the filter, but when I refilled it, it only took about 4.5 quarts.. Went back and checked it again after I did some driving to make sure everything worked fine. Did everything the video said to do. Transfer case took about 1.5 quarts. And no, I did not use the same fluid for both.
 






Just curious how did your old fluid look?
 






Transmission fluid was very dark, almost black. Transfer case fluid wasn't all that dark like I thought it would be, not clean by any measures, but not as bad as the transmission.
